Cheapest Available Forest Park Apartments for Rent

 

The cheapest available apartment rental in Forest Park, GA is a 1 Bed unit found at Sheraton House Apartments in the Ft. Gillem neighborhood priced from $800. Park Manor Apartments in the Ft. Gillem neighborhood has the second lowest priced unit, which is a 1 Bed apartment currently listed from $899. Here is today’s list of the most affordable Forest Park apartments for rent:

Frequently Asked Questions about Forest Park

What type of rentals are currently available in Forest Park?

There are currently 107 Apartments for Rent in Forest Park, GA with pricing that ranges from $650 to $3,707. There are also 109 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Forest Park ranging from $600 to $7,500.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Forest Park?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Forest Park ranges from $600 to $7,500 with an average monthly rent of $2,146.

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Forest Park?

For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Forest Park range from $1,199 to $3,707,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,199 to $7,500.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,599 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,495.
